Glue for stone and concrete

Adhesives for stone and concrete describe adhesives that are used for bonding, repairing, and linking either natural stone or artificial stone and cement-based materials. Such adhesives are made with careful consideration of the characteristics of stone and concrete; hence, they must have the desired tensile strength required for construction processes.

1.1 Epoxy Adhesive
Epoxy adhesive is chosen for bonding stone and concrete because of its strength and bonding power.
Properties: Good bonding ability, high bonding force, good durability, higher resistance to heat and humidity.
Common areas of use: Interior stone works like terrazzo flooring, marble tops, etc.
1.2 Polyurethane based adhesive
Polyurethane based adhesive is suitable for bonding light stone and concrete surfaces.
Properties: Good water resistance, heat resistance, versatility in bonding stone surfaces, etc.
Common areas of use: Joining interior walls or exterior walls, bonding concrete blocks, attaching tiles.
1.3 PU Concrete adhesive
PU adhesive has a high penetrating quality resulting in good penetration of concrete and stone.
Properties: High penetration, flexibility, and crack resistance along with efficiency in humid environments.
Common areas of application: Grout cracks in concrete.
1.4 Cement based adhesive
Cement based adhesive mixed with latex is what causes it to gain flexibility as well as bonding properties.
Properties: Compatibility to cement base, flexibility, and economical price.

Typical Construction Workflow
The necessary construction cycle ensures the expected quality and reliability of bonding.
1. Preparing the Base: Concrete and stone surfaces need to be cleaned up, being free of dust and oil. Surfaces may be either dry or even wet (depending on the glue used);
2. Preparing the Glue: In case of two-component epoxy glue, the glue components must be mixed in the required proportions. In case of the use of one-component MS polymer glue it is required to shake it well before application;
3. Applying and Connecting: Glue should be evenly applied on the overall bonding area (point or total bonding). The system should be bonded quickly relying on the indicated time frames;
4. Dismantling and Curing: Glued parts are held in place preventing them from shifting. Curing needs 30 to 60 minutes and takes full strength in 24 hours;
5. Finishing: The glue that has not been cured is removed.
Most Common Problems and Solutions
• Peeling or formation of holes: the reason is not cleaned base surface or the failure to wait for curing. It is necessary to clean the surface before bonding the stones and do not load it for the time taken for the glue curing;
• Staining of the surface: caused by wrong glue formula. It is necessary to use MS glue or glue suitable for stone products only;
• Cracking of the bonded area after curing: due to poor material of the used glue. The materials should use flexible MS/PU glue;
• Curing too slow: due to low temperature and wrong mixing. The construction should be held in 15-30 degrees and the proportions should be observed.
